Rava Ladoo Recipe | Sooji Laddu Recipe

Overview

Rava Ladoo, also known as Sooji Laddu, is a delightful Indian sweet made from semolina, ghee, sugar, and an assortment of nuts and spices. These sweet, round treats are perfect for festivals, celebrations, or simply as a treat to enjoy with your family. Easy to prepare and absolutely delicious, this recipe yields approximately 20 ladoos, making it perfect for sharing or storing for later enjoyment.

Ingredients

Ingredient Quantity
Ghee 1 tablespoon
Raisins 1/4 cup
Cashew nuts (roughly halved) 1/4 cup
Ghee (for roasting) 2 tablespoons
Sooji (Semolina/Rava) 2 cups
Ghee (for mixture) 1/2 cup
Dessicated Coconut (dry fine variety) 1/4 cup
Sugar (finely powdered) 3/4 cup
Cardamom Powder (Elaichi) 2 teaspoons

Preparation Steps

Step 1: Roast the Nuts

  1. Heat Ghee: Begin by heating 1 tablespoon of ghee in a small pan over low heat.
  2. Roast Cashew Nuts: Add the roughly halved cashew nuts to the hot ghee and roast them until they turn lightly golden and crisp.
  3. Add Raisins: Once the cashews are roasted, add in the raisins and sauté for a few seconds until they plump up.
  4. Set Aside: Turn off the heat and set the mixture aside to cool.

Step 2: Roast the Semolina

  1. Preheat the Pan: Take a separate pan and preheat it over medium heat.
  2. Roast Sooji: Add the semolina (sooji) to the pan and roast for about 4 to 5 minutes. Keep stirring until you can smell the roasted aroma, ensuring that it does not brown or burn.
  3. Cool the Sooji: Once roasted, remove the semolina from heat and let it cool.

Step 3: Prepare the Mixture

  1. Powder the Sugar: In a mixer grinder, add the finely powdered sugar and blend it until it’s very fine.
  2. Mix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the roasted semolina, dessicated coconut, and cardamom powder with the powdered sugar. Blend these ingredients until they form a coarse powder.
  3. Combine Nuts: Add the roasted cashew nuts and raisins to this mixture and stir well.

Step 4: Form the Ladoos

  1. Add Ghee: Melt the remaining ghee (1/2 cup) and pour it into the mixture. Combine everything thoroughly.
  2. Shape the Ladoos: While the mixture is still warm, shape it into 20 equal-sized balls (ladoos). If the mixture has cooled down and is not forming into balls, you can add a tablespoon of warm milk or ghee to help it come together.
  3. Compress: As you shape the ladoos, compress the mixture firmly with your fingers. This will help the ladoos hold their shape and become firmer.

Step 5: Storage and Serving

  1. Store: Once all the ladoos are shaped, place them in an airtight container. They can be stored for about two weeks at room temperature.
